I was inspired by old XTree Gold, on the left side is local, on right 
side is Server side. You can type the full path in the field or press 
browse. You must type in the full FTP URL (including user and pass) on 
the field. Pressing refresh will refresh the list. Top listbox on each 
side is folder list, botton listbox is file list. You can select 
multiple files. Operations will work on multiple files. Theres a libURL 
log field below. So far I tested all the operations. You can upload, 
download, traverse, rename one or multiple files. you go tagging the 
files, and press the desired operation button. It works, I think I'll
